Trend Micro enhances InterScan with reputation services

Trend Micro on Monday announced it’s enhanced its InterScan Gateway Security Appliance line with filtering protection provided through Trend’s in-the-cloud reputation services to identify dangerous Web sites and e-mail sources.

LG NAS Adds Blu-ray Drive
11/21/09
LG's N4B1 NAS box is neither a comprehensive media server nor a particularly fast performer, but as a network-attached storage device, it's quick enough for home/small-business file serving. The unit--available at this writing for around $700--is also the sturdiest and quite possibly the best-looking such box I've had my hands on. You also can't beat it's HTML configuration interface for looks or ease of learning and use. But none of that compares to the N4B1's most outstanding feature: an integrated Blu-ray burner, unique among NAS products in the SMB/SOHO market.

The InterScan Gateway Security Appliance line is used for gateway-based URL filtering for corporate users as well as content filtering of spam, antivirus and antispyware. Trend Micro is bolstering this defense through its reputation services,which identify malicious Web sites and sources of spam.

“These reputation services are done in Trend’s data centers," says Bill Hansy, Trend Micro’s product marketing manager. There, an ongoing analysis of the life cycle of hundreds of millions of Web domains leads to an assessment of the trustworthiness of the site. Web sites that come and go at a very fast rate, for example, are probably involved in activities associated with botnets or spam, and InterScan users have the option of filtering this content out.

InterScan Gateway Security Appliance, which supports Trend Micro’s reputation services, is available in eight models that start at $4,490.
